• + 0 comments
    public static void main(String[] args) {
            Scanner sc = new Scanner(System.in);
            int n = sc.nextInt();
            String s = sc.next();
            
            int nOV = 0;     // no of valleys
            int altitude = 0;   // current level
            for(char c : s.toCharArray()){
                if(altitude == 0 && c == 'D')
                nOV++;
    	altitude= (c=='D')? --altitude : ++ altitude; 
    		}
    	System.out.println(nOV);
    	}